The Lake Roosevelt Raiders just played yesterday, but they'll still head out to face the Lakeside Knights at 3:30 p.m. on Saturday. Both come into the match bolstered by wins in their previous matches.
On Friday, even if it wasn't a dominant performance, Lake Roosevelt beat Tonasket 33-29.
Meanwhile, Lakeside posted their biggest win since December 10, 2024 on Thursday. They blew past Wallace 67-44. The victory made it back-to-back wins for the Knights.
Lakeside is also on a roll lately: they've won three of their last four games, which provided a nice bump to their 8-5 record this season. The wins came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 56.0 points per game. As for Lake Roosevelt, the victory got them back to even at 9-9.
Lake Roosevelt was able to grind out a solid win over Lakeside in their previous matchup back in January of 2024, winning 54-47. The rematch might be a little tougher for Lake Roosevelt since the squad won't have the home-court advantage this time around. We'll see if the change in venue makes a difference.
